// FW_CHANNEL_STABLE pins Ridgefox thermostats to the signed stable
// update channel. Do not point devices at the beta feed without a
// countersigned manifest; rollback protection rejects lower versions.
// Review the signing chain before approving changes here. The channel
// manifest is pinned to the build identified below.

pipeline stamp: htk31_f769b577b3028a4e9958e5bb8d1259a

Subject: Quickstore 4.2 — bloom filter now fronts the KV layer

Plugin authors: starting with this release, Quickstore places a bloom filter ahead of the key-value store. Negative lookups return faster; false positives fall through safely. No API changes are required on your side. Verify your plugin against the staging build referenced below.

session token of fahif-tadup = htk3_9c7

**Alert: PickPath optimizer plugin timeout.** This alert is raised when a third-party scoring plugin registered with the Bintrail optimizer exceeds its 250ms budget three times within one optimization cycle. When triggered, your plugin is temporarily quarantined and pick lists fall back to the default scorer, so throughput numbers may look unusually flat. Please profile your scoring hook before requesting reinstatement. To request reinstatement or discuss budget extensions, write to the optimizer platform team.

escalation mailbox, kagep-tawef: ulawyn_norius_gordor@paliqlabs.corp

## Configuration

Syncloom resolves calendar conflicts by last-writer-wins unless `SYNC_STRICT_MODE=true`, which you'll probably want for the audit. All toggles live in `.env` — nothing is read from disk at runtime, promise. The conflict resolver also needs an API secret for the Meridian scheduling backend, which goes on the following line.

vault entry, yahif-yajep: COURIER_KEY29=b802bdf8034096b65a51c6ba5abe2

Handover note — hardware lab access (for new starters)

Welcome to the Brintwell team. The hardware lab on level 1 stays locked at all times; your badge won't open it until week two. Until then, sign the lab log at the door and keep food outside. Anti-static straps are by the bench. The door keypad takes the code below.

staff pass of kawip-hawef = bdg-QLP-2